Characteristic polynomials for random band matrices near the threshold

Abstract

The paper continues previous works which study the behavior of second correlation function of characteristic polynomials of the special case of n× n one-dimensional Gaussian Hermitian random band matrices, when the covariance of the elements is determined by the matrix J=(-W2+1)-1. Applying the transfer matrix approach, we study the case when the bandwidth W is proportional to the threshold n
